无码人妻A片一区二区三区_18禁裸乳无遮挡啪啪无码免费_91精品亚?影视在线?看_人人妻人人爽人人澡AV_国产精品人妻一区二区三区四区_午夜免费影视

中培偉業IT資訊頻道
您現在的位置:首頁 > IT資訊 > 數據庫 > Mysql為什么不建議使用Text字段?

Mysql為什么不建議使用Text字段?

2024-02-20 17:30:11 | 來源:企業IT培訓

在MySQL中,TEXT字段是一種用于存儲較大文本數據的數據類型。雖然TEXT字段對于存儲大量文本數據非常方便,但也存在一些潛在的問題,因此在某些情況下,不建議頻繁或過度使用TEXT字段,以下是一些原因:

1、查詢性能

TEXT字段通常需要更多的存儲空間,并且在查詢時可能會導致性能下降。對TEXT字段的搜索和排序操作可能會比較耗時,特別是在大型數據表中。

2、索引和全文搜索的限制

在TEXT字段上創建索引可能不如在其他字段上創建索引那樣高效。此外,一些數據庫引擎對于在TEXT字段上執行全文搜索的性能支持也有限。

3、內存占用

TEXT字段的數據通常不會被完全加載到內存中,因此在進行查詢時可能需要從磁盤讀取,這可能導致額外的I/O操作,影響查詢性能。

4、備份和恢復

由于TEXT字段的數據通常較大,因此在進行備份和恢復時可能需要更多的時間和存儲空間。

5、表碎片

頻繁更新TEXT字段的數據可能導致表碎片化,從而影響整體性能。這是因為MySQL將TEXT字段數據存儲在單獨的區域,可能導致磁盤碎片。

雖然TEXT字段在某些情況下是必需的,特別是當需要存儲大量文本數據時,但在其他情況下,如果文本數據的大小是可預測的并且不會經常更改,可以考慮使用VARCHAR或CHAR字段。這些字段對于較小的文本數據更有效,并且在索引、查詢和排序等方面的性能表現更好。根據具體需求,還可以考慮使用專門針對全文搜索的解決方案,如全文搜索引擎或全文搜索插件。

標簽: MySQL Text字段
主站蜘蛛池模板: 欧美一级在线观看久 | XXXXX69日本少妇 | 精品国产午夜理论片不卡精品 | JAPANESE国产在线观看 | 亚洲精品久久av无码一区二区 | 日本黄色三级视频 | 精品人妻中文av一区二区三区 | 欧美影院adc | 狠狠色噜噜狠狠狠888777米奇 | 亚洲色无色A片一区二区农夫 | 中文字幕乱码亚洲无线三区 | 国内激情视频在线观看 | 久久免费看少妇a片特黄 | 日本人六九视频69jzz免费 | 激情亚洲一区二区三区四区 | 免费观看Aⅴ成人片 | 女人A级毛片19毛水真多 | 1234区中文字幕在线观看 | 欧美人与动zozo | 国产精品日日夜夜 | 日韩欧洲亚洲美三区中文幕 | 国产女人乱子对白AV片 | 色先锋中文字幕 | 色午夜日本高清视频WWW | 亚洲国产精品va在线播放 | 91插插插影库永久免费 | 久久大香萑太香蕉AV黄软件 | A级毛片100部免费观看 | 久久精品亚洲乱码伦伦中文 | 日韩AⅤ人妻无码一区二区 亚洲国产综合在线播放av66 | 中文字幕无码成人免费视频 | 欧美乱论 | 欧美精品人人做人人爱视频 | 久久99久国产麻精品66 | 欧美大屁股BBBBXXXX | 日本另类αv欧美另类aⅴ | 国产精品不卡视频 | 国产二区视频在线观看 | 国产欧美日韩一区二区加勒比 | 欧美大奶网 | 亚洲精品成a人在线观看☆ 久久高清内射无套 |